WebApr 25, 2024 · The Nashville area has plenty of wonderful wildflower trails. Two of the most popular can be found at Beaman Park. On the 2.5-mile Henry Hollow Trail and the Ridgetop Trail (a 1.2-mile offshoot), spring wildflowers include dwarf larkspur, wild geranium, shooting stars, fire pinks, and occasional lady’s slipper orchids. Cades Cove Loop Road - Townsend. Paul Chambers - AllTrails. Cades Cove is one of the most famous natural landmarks in Tennessee, and the 10.5-mile loop trail that runs around its perimeter is both beautiful and available throughout the year.

WebApr 3, 2024 · Popular hiking trails and waterfalls in Eastern Tennessee. White Rock Loop at Buffalo Mountain Park: This is a moderately difficult hike that is a 5.1-mile loop. There are occasional steep inclines, making the hike rather difficult at times. Overall, the hike offers beautiful mountain views of Northeast Tennessee and is a well-maintained trail ... WebApr 6, 2024 · Buffalo Mountain Park is a 725-acre natural resource area and functions as a nature preserve primarily for hiking, picnicking, and nature programs. The park offers several hikes for varying skill levels, but White Rock offers the most stunning, panoramic views. Gain 3,217ft. in elevation on the 4-mile White Rock Loop.

Buffalo Mountain Park is a 725-acre natural resource area obtained in 1994 through a land swap with the U.S. Forest Service. The park is located on the north slope of Buffalo Mountain and consists of steep topography and densely forested land.
